This Sharp Practice tale is set in the 1857 Indian Mutiny where a group of civilians are trying to get to safety. However, the game quickly changed into a rescue mission, where a group of loyal natives ended up trapped in the building.
A group of sepoy rabble deployed on the road...
whilst a group of civilians raced along the riverbank hoping to help their comrades in the building.
Two groups of badmashes headed straight for the building.
The sepoy rabble continued along the road along with support from some skirmishers. Where were the British?
The sepoy rabble deployed into line and poured fire into the building, causing casualties.

The badmashes continued their advance on the building.
Hooray, the main British force had arrived and immediately deployed into a firing line.
The best sepoy troops however, had advanced too far and came under a murderous fire from the British line. Soon they were broken and running from the field. At this point it was looking like the British mught pull off a victory.
However, the badmashes charged the few remaining loyal natives in the building, wiping them out.
Meanwhile, the mutinous skirmishers turned their attention to the British line.
A firefight now ensued between the sepoy rabble and the British line. It was a race to seen who whould break first. Unfortunately for the British, their luck wasn't in and they retired from the field leaving the victorious mutineers to lick their wounds.
